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87686345183 1702573 972 25196 83207141927
1179426732 553143315
1179426732 553143315
51669 274470165 85 9954213102
All about undefined
Interested in learning more?
1179426732 553143315
51669 274470165 85 9954213102
See more
5458890779 041 7917728254
3424162323 3203 9220334 08
See more
638727647 425201 69197806301
481 83 6900 31940 50648540
See more